摘 要:以不覆盖的处理为对照,研究了冬小麦期覆盖秸秆对夏玉米土壤水分动态变化及产量的影响。结果表明,秸秆覆盖有明显的增产效果。受充足的降雨影响,秸秆覆盖的保墒效果不太明显,但夏玉米的水分利用效率(WUE)有较大的提高。秸秆覆盖对表土层(0~30cm)具有明显的保墒效果,尤其是夏玉米生长前期。在深土层(100~110cm)秸秆覆盖处理的土壤含水率低于不覆盖处理,形成一个缺水带。一年两熟条件下,夏玉米可以充分利用夏季多雨的特性,结合秸秆覆盖措施,可提高对降雨的利用效率。Taking bare surface as CK, this paper discussed effect of straw-mulch during wheat stage on soil water dynamic changes and yield of summer maize. Results showed that mulched treatments had significant effect on increasing yield. Influenced by plenty of rainfall, effect of straw-mulch on saving water was not significant, however, straw-mulch was beneficial to the water use efficiency(WUE) of summer maize. Straw-mulch had significant effect on saving water of the surface soil(0~30 cm),especially in the front of growth period of summer maize. On deep soil layer(100~110 cm),the soil content of straw-mulch was lower than that of bare surface. Summer maize which may make best use of plenty of rainfall in summer had significant influence in increasing the use efficiency of rainfall if it was applied with straw-mulch.
